Because sound is a wave, it is possible to make a diffraction grating for sound from a large board with several parallel slots for the sound to go through. When 10 kHz sound waves pass through such a grating, listeners 10 m from the grating report "loud spots" 1.4 m on both sides of center. What is the spacing between the slots? Use 340 m / s for the speed of sound. | Numerade

SOLVED:Diffraction from sound speaker The opening of a stereo speaker is shaped like a slit. Determine the maximum width such that the first diffraction minimum of sound is at least 45^∘ on each side of the direction in which the speaker points. Perform the calculations for sound waves of frequency (a) 200 Hz , (b) 1000 Hz , and (c) 10,000 Hz. The speed of sound is 340 m / s .
